Valspar

Warm Sunshine

3004-6B

Warm Sunshine is a light golden peach, closer to honeyed cream than lemon yellow. The warmth is friendly. Use it in breakfast rooms, nurseries, or north-facing bedrooms that need a little lift.

The color can become more golden in afternoon sun. Pair it with painted white furniture, woven shades, or soft green accents. Cool gray floors may make the yellow-orange side feel louder.

Warm Sunshine in Different Light

Light temperature is measured in Kelvin: a warm 2700K bulb pulls colors toward yellow, while 5000K daylight reads cooler and truer. Check the color at the time of day you actually use the room.

LRV measures how much light a color reflects, from 0 (black) to 100 (pure white). Below about 50 a color needs good lighting to avoid going flat, 60 and up helps brighten a room, and most whites sit above 80.
